AI has actually penetrated nearly every field and market, and HR is no exception. Companies are incorporating different AI technologies into their procedures, with 91% of international executives actively scaling up their efforts. HR teams and organizations experience various gain from AI-powered automation, information analysis and other functions. AI in HR adoption likewise brings brand-new difficulties, like algorithmic biases, data privacy concerns and ethical questions about replacing human judgment.

Teams should understand the capabilities and restrictions of AI in HR and interact company standards to concerned stakeholders. If a company uses AI tools to assess job applications, working with managers ought to inform prospects how the innovation works and how their details is dealt with.

Legacy systems, fragmented data, complicated combinations, and rising security risks continue to slow improvement efforts. This leads HR product designers to focus on structure merged platforms that decrease complexity and accelerate innovation. As AI adoption boosts, lots of HR systems are revealing their restrictions. Older platforms were not developed to support contemporary information circulations, combinations, or automation, that makes system modernization a growing top priority.

Around 69% of organizations already utilize SaaS or hybrid cloud HR innovation, with adoption expected to reach 83% by 2027. When a complete replacement is not possible, business modernize in phases by integrating tradition systems with SaaS HR tools through APIs or connecting them to composable cloud platforms. This approach enhances exposure and performance without a complete system rebuild.
